What Research and Guidance Say About Climate-Controlled Transport
Maintaining the required temperature range is essential to preserving potency and preventing sample degradation. International and national guidance and many peer-reviewed studies emphasize validated temperature control, continuous monitoring with alarms and secure data logs, and contamination-resistant interiors to ensure product safety and regulatory compliance. These principles apply to vaccines, biologics, and sensitive equine biotech materials where small deviations can reduce efficacy or invalidate study samples. For buyers new to this category, the combination of validated refrigeration performance, documented qualification and calibration, and traceable monitoring are the foundation of an auditable cold chain.
Temperature validation and continuous data logging lower the risk of potency loss. Health Canada guidance and international cold-chain best practices recommend verifiable temperature records for biologics during transport.
Alarmed monitoring with remote notifications shortens response time to temperature excursions, reducing sample loss and limiting costly product waste.
Contamination-resistant interiors and smooth, cleanable surfaces reduce the chance of cross-contamination and simplify compliance with biosafety protocols.
Modular racking and secure packaging reduce mechanical stress and temperature stratification, which can be important in stability and field trial sample integrity.
Peer-reviewed analyses of cold-chain failures show that most losses are preventable with validated equipment, redundant power or battery backups, and operator training.
